Richard Chikwe, known to many as Coach Rich, has always had an unwavering passion for fitness, rooted in his upbringing in Bulawayo, Zimbabwe.
From the age of six, he was drawn to physical training, setting the foundation for a lifelong commitment to health and wellness. What began as a childhood interest has since blossomed into a career that continues to inspire and transform lives.
In 2014, Coach Rich began his formal fitness journey, guided by Coach Bhekimpilo Kawere at a small backyard gym. This early exposure helped him develop core values such as discipline, resilience, and hard work.
His skills were further refined at Dynamics Health Studio, a commercial gym in Bulawayo’s CBD, where he met Prince Carter, also known as Coach Carter. Coach Carter not only sharpened his fitness abilities but also helped Coach Rich turn his passion into a profession. This mentorship led him to earn his certification in Physical and Fitness Training from Lupane State University.
Beyond personal development, Coach Rich has made a significant impact in the competitive bodybuilding and fitness world. His accomplishments include winning a silver medal in the Men's Fitness Category at the 2022 Bulawayo Classic Bodybuilding and Fitness Competitions.
In 2024, he further cemented his reputation by securing gold in both the Sports Model and Jeans Model categories at the WFF Midlands Competitions in Gweru, as well as a silver in the Bermuda Model category.
That same year, he earned silver in the Jeans Model category at the WFF Grand Prix, showcasing his exceptional talent and dedication to the sport.
